@mrj Well does the US actually have any UMTS networks up and running yet? If not then I doubt you'll see the Z1010 for sale there anytime soon as it would completely useless as it can't use any of the US GSM frequencies.

@axxxr What is your source for this info? I only ask because I have heard other people say that it won't be out on 3UK until Autumn or even not at all. I have been hoping that has just been idle speculation but if you have a more official source then 24th Feb sounds hopeful!
